MacIonyte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name MacIonyte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name MacIonyte occurs in Northern Ireland more than any other country or territory. It may also occur as: Macionytė. For other possible spellings of this surname click here.

How Common Is The Last Name MacIonyte?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 4,034,050th most commonly used last name worldwide, borne by around 1 in 303,647,746 people. The surname MacIonyte is primarily found in Europe, where 92 percent of MacIonyte live; 88 percent live in Northern Europe and 71 percent live in British Isles.

The surname is most commonly used in Northern Ireland, where it is carried by 12 people, or 1 in 153,753. In Northern Ireland it is mostly concentrated in: Ulster, where 100 percent reside. Aside from Northern Ireland this surname is found in 7 countries. It is also found in England, where 21 percent reside and Lithuania, where 8 percent reside.
